St. Louis In House Puppy Training

Read More
Read Less

At Dog Training Elite St. Louis, we believe in-home dog training is the most effective way to address your dog’s needs. Unlike traditional obedience schools, which often provide a one-size-fits-all approach, in-home training allows our team to observe and address your dog’s behavioral issues within the environment they naturally occur.

For instance, if your dog has a habit of barking at the mailman or chasing the neighbor’s cat, our trainers can work directly with your dog in those exact situations. This personalized approach ensures we target the root of the behavior, making it easier for your dog to understand and follow commands.

In-home training minimizes distractions and allows your dog to focus better on learning. By starting in the home and gradually introducing group lessons, our program helps your dog retain commands and respond accordingly to their surroundings.

Benefits of In-Home Training Techniques

Read More
Read Less
  • Develop a Strong Bond
  • Dogs thrive in training sessions when they are with their loved ones. Learning commands is a way for your dog to connect with you, and your praise and treats make the experience enjoyable and strengthen your bond.

    Sending your dog to obedience school separates you from the training process, missing out on this important connection. At Dog Training Elite, we involve you and your family in every in-home training session. Our trainers focus on teaching you how to train your dog and enhance your bonding experience.

  • Quickly Teach Obedience
  • Obedience commands are crucial for any comprehensive dog training program. They ensure your dog’s safety and prevent unwanted behaviors. At the core of successful training, these commands must be mastered before progressing.

    Our in-home training program emphasizes foundational obedience, teaching essential commands like sit, down, come, and drop it. Once these basics are solidified, our trainers will guide you and your dog through more advanced skills.

  • Correct Problem Behaviors
  • If your dog jumps on guests, charges the door when the bell rings, or begs at the table, these issues can be effectively corrected with the right training techniques.

    Group classes or basic training programs often overlook these specific problem behaviors, which usually occur in your dog's familiar home environment. Bringing a trusted trainer into your home ensures these behaviors are addressed in the context where they happen, leading to more effective solutions.
